POSITION SUMMARY

The Security team member is responsible for ensuring the safety and security of the community, residents, and staff while also fulfilling receptionist duties. This role includes monitoring the premises, conducting routine rounds, answering phones, and providing exceptional customer service to residents, visitors, and employees.

RESPONSIBILITIES include but are not limited to the following:

  • Maintain a safe and secure environment by conducting regular security checks throughout the community, including outdoor rounds during overnight shifts.
  • Monitor and control access to the building, ensuring only authorized individuals enter the premises.
  • Respond promptly to emergency situations, call lights, and incidents, providing assistance as needed.
  • Answer and direct phone calls professionally and courteously.
  • Greet and assist residents, visitors, and staff in a friendly and helpful manner.
  • Maintain accurate records of security rounds, incidents, and visitor logs.
  • Assist with monitoring security cameras and reporting any suspicious activities.
  • Collaborate with other staff members to ensure the well-being and comfort of residents.
  • Follow all safety procedures and protocols, including fire and emergency evacuation plans.
  • Support administrative tasks assigned, including light clerical duties and handling deliveries.
